A slang term for having an unintentional accident causing property damage and/or bodily damage and/or death to the person causing the accident
#1. (employee calling boss when coming back from lunch): "Some dude bit it about 100 yds ahead, and the police are here. I have to take an alternate route. I'll be there in about 15 minutes."
#2. "That skateboarder sure bit it when he didn't make the 360."

Acronym standing for "booze in transit". Used widely in urban environments as a time-efficient pregame on trains, cabs, and for the irresponsible, automobiles while en route to one's final destination.
